## Deployment

Shipping the Ledgerwren admin bulk-edit feature is mostly painless, but two things bite people: the bulk-edit queue needs to drain before you restart the workers, and the table-lock timeout must match what the database proxy expects, or mass edits silently roll back. Deploy during the low-traffic window if you can — bulk operations mid-flight will retry but they're noisy. The values we deploy with in production are as follows.

settings of yageg-yahap:
[gorael]
team = olieth
access_code = ac_941d74
owner = brieth.aldiel
host = gorael.tolvaqio.internal
port = 6379
peer = briwyn.urlaqtech.internal
salt = 116e6622
pin = 1957

## Changelog — Font vendoring defaults changed

As of this release, the Bracken UI build no longer fetches third-party fonts at build time. All typefaces used by the Lanternwell suite are now vendored into the repo under a dedicated assets directory, and the fetch step is skipped by default. If you're onboarding, nothing to install — the fonts travel with the checkout. The build flags controlling this behavior are listed below.

settings of hadup-yafog:
LAMAEL_PIN=3761
LAMAEL_TENANT=istmir
LAMAEL_METRICS_HOST=metrics.lamael.plorvasys.test
LAMAEL_SEAL=seal_8ea68500
LAMAEL_STANDBY_TEAM=fraok

**Q: How does the KioskGuard watchdog recover from a hung session?**

KioskGuard pings the Lumabox kiosk shell every five seconds. After three missed heartbeats it kills the shell process, clears volatile session state, and relaunches in attract mode. Crash dumps are written to an encrypted local partition and rotated after seven days. The watchdog itself runs as a separate hardened service and cannot be disabled from the kiosk UI. To unlock the dump partition during an audit, use the passphrase below.

recovery phrase for kahof-kahif: ulaix-zorox

# Greenhouse controller — sensor drift notes (Vernalis Pod 3)
# Humidity probes drift upward ~0.4% per week after calibration, so the
# controller applies a decay-corrected offset nightly. Do not zero the
# offsets manually; it breaks the trend model. Drift history is stored
# in the calibration database, reachable via the connection string below.

replica DSN, yahog-kawig: redis://istox_svc:um@db-8a67.halixforge.test:5432/frawyn